Transaction 8453866e9d78cdee7e5c871a72685a1f506e8082db7888d25f3ca65c2406eaab
1 Input
1 Output
-
8453866e9d78cdee7e5c871a72685a1f506e8082db7888d25f3ca65c2406eaab:0
- value
- 20000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 708c9f513c3e5aad057bd7a67b4302d33ef1d7cd OP_EQUAL
- address
- 3Bx84e4SGQHEuqcwPq92Km9Cixv6i5wKmn